收藏
回答

urlscheme.generate的env_version传入trial,但还是跳转的正式版?

文档上(https://developers.weixin.qq.com/miniprogram/dev/api-backend/open-api/url-scheme/urlscheme.generate.html)是有提供env_version字段打开指定的小程序版本,但是使用的时候env_version传入"trial",生成的urlscheme跳转的还是正式版,这是为什么呢?为什么文档上有写但是不生效呢

回答关注问题邀请回答
收藏

1 个回答

  • Rochester
    Rochester
    2021-10-21

    我也遇到这问题了,但是解决了。

    生成的链接需要在微信外打开,如果在内部打开的话是会跳到正式版的。最好就是拼接第三方链接在浏览器内调起微信小程序,这样打开的就是体验版的

    2021-10-21
    有用
    回复 6
    • 六天晴
      六天晴
      2021-10-21
      我的也是从外部浏览器(qq浏览器和百度)打开的,方式是window.location.href=urlscheme,但是也还是跳到正式版是为什么呢,你有遇到过吗
      2021-10-21
      回复
    • 六天晴
      六天晴
      2021-10-21
      不过我后面试了好几个手机,有个手机又是打开的体验版,其他的都是正式版,好奇怪啊
      2021-10-21
      回复
    • Rochester
      Rochester
      2021-10-22回复六天晴
      那我不太清楚哦。。我这样是能行得通的,我还没有遇到过从外部浏览器跳到不正确的版本
      2021-10-22
      回复
    • 六天晴
      六天晴
      2021-10-22回复Rochester
      这个query你有传吗
      2021-10-22
      回复
    • 廾匸
      廾匸
      04-09
      得亏是看到你这个回复了。这个文档写的也是没事了,这么重要一句话放在后面,这会子库库测试端打开正式版小程序,把地址打出来长按使用微信跳转链接 就打开了测试版小程序,我也是服微信了。他自己挺会完啊
      04-09
      回复
    查看更多(1)
登录 后发表内容